lmi-commits
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[lmi-commits] [5289] Fix defect introduced 20050114T1947Z


From: Greg Chicares
Subject: [lmi-commits] [5289] Fix defect introduced 20050114T1947Z
Date: Thu, 15 Sep 2011 10:59:17 +0000

Revision: 5289
          http://svn.sv.gnu.org/viewvc/?view=rev&root=lmi&revision=5289
Author:   chicares
Date:     2011-09-15 10:59:17 +0000 (Thu, 15 Sep 2011)
Log Message:
-----------
Fix defect introduced 20050114T1947Z

Modified Paths:
--------------
    lmi/trunk/ChangeLog
    lmi/trunk/ihs_avmly.cpp

Modified: lmi/trunk/ChangeLog
===================================================================
--- lmi/trunk/ChangeLog 2011-09-15 10:25:45 UTC (rev 5288)
+++ lmi/trunk/ChangeLog 2011-09-15 10:59:17 UTC (rev 5289)
@@ -28496,3 +28496,27 @@
   ihs_avstrtgy.cpp
 Reflect 7702 and 7702A treatment of term rider in payment strategies.
 
+20110914T0017Z <address@hidden> [610]
+
+  ihs_avstrtgy.cpp
+Refactor.
+
+20110914T0053Z <address@hidden> [609]
+
+  ihs_avstrtgy.cpp
+Remove a marker for a defect already resolved: employer premium is
+zeroed out in AccountValue::SolveGuarPremium().
+
+20110915T1025Z <address@hidden> [608]
+
+  account_value.hpp
+  ihs_avmly.cpp
+Refactor.
+
+20110915T1059Z <address@hidden> [608]
+
+  ihs_avmly.cpp
+Fix defect introduced 20050114T1947Z, from an original file predating
+the lmi epoch. The database differentiates initial and post-initial
+minimum specamt, but only the latter was used.
+

Modified: lmi/trunk/ihs_avmly.cpp
===================================================================
--- lmi/trunk/ihs_avmly.cpp     2011-09-15 10:25:45 UTC (rev 5288)
+++ lmi/trunk/ihs_avmly.cpp     2011-09-15 10:59:17 UTC (rev 5289)
@@ -712,8 +712,11 @@
 
 double AccountValue::minimum_specified_amount(bool issuing_now, bool 
term_rider) const
 {
-(void)&issuing_now; // This argument hasn't been used yet, but should be.
-    return term_rider ? MinRenlBaseSpecAmt : MinRenlSpecAmt;
+    return
+          issuing_now
+        ? (term_rider ? MinIssBaseSpecAmt  : MinIssSpecAmt )
+        : (term_rider ? MinRenlBaseSpecAmt : MinRenlSpecAmt)
+        ;
 }
 
 //============================================================================




reply via email to

[Prev in Thread] Current Thread [Next in Thread]